Birmingham sees over 5% drop in violent crime despite overall crime increase this year

BIRMINGHAM, Ala. (WBMA) – The City of Birmingham is showing positive movement in its ongoing fight against violent crime, according to Year-to-Date (YTD) data released by the Birmingham Police Department (BPD) as of September 22, 2025.

Overall, offenses have increased by nearly 3 percent compared to the same period in 2024, rising from 7,869 incidents to 8,092. However, violent crime is down citywide by over 5 percent. This upward trend in overall crime is primarily driven by an increase in theft, up nearly 12 percent from a year ago.
